Rectangular Bronze Pillar Candle Chandelier
This Rectangular Bronze Pillar Candle Chandelier is different from the Palazzo T4 Chandelier in a number of ways, though they both are lit by candles. Most obviously, this is a bronze piece, not an acrylic one, but primary difference is that the candles are on this fixture are artificial. They are randomly shaped to mimic the look of real pillar candles, but the whole thing is wired with electric lights. This means that you never have to swap out candles or worry about fire safety, though you won't get the slight flickering warmth of a real flame, either. Price: $659.
